WHAT THEY ARE: These are a pre-made pre-designed screen print that comes ready for you to apply. We couldn't of made it any easier. We did all the work so you don't have to! They melt into your shirt and will not crack like heat transfer vinyls can do over time with washing. Note: these are not a heat transfer vinyl.

You can apply them to shirts, pillows, & more. You just need to make sure you are applying to the proper material types listed below:

  • Cotton
  • Cotton/Poly
  • Polyester

LET'S GET READY TO PRESS: ***DO NOT USE A TEFLON SHEET WITH APPLICATION!!!***

  1. Set Your Heat Press to the following:

370 degrees F

Time: 5 seconds

Pressure: Medium

2. Preheat Your Material (t-shirt, pillow, bag, etc.) for 5 seconds to remove any wrinkles & moisture.

3. Position your transfer face down and press for 5 seconds.

4. Peel transfer carrier off while HOT & make sure you peel in a smooth even motion.

TROUBLESHOOT

What went wrong??? If you are experiencing issues in the application of your Heat Press Transfer we are here to help. Likely, you are doing one or more things wrong when applying and it is affecting your outcome. Please move step by step down our list and it will help you figure out just what went wrong during your application.

  • What material are you applying it to? These can only be applied to Cotton, Polyester, & Cotton/Poly blends. They will NOT apply to canvas, burlap, performance material shirts, etc. You should have no issues if you are applying to the three types of materials: Cotton, Polyester, & Cotton/Poly blends.
  • Are you using a Heat Press? If no, that is your problem. These can only be applied with a Heat Press.
  • What temperature is your Heat Press set to? It must be set to 370 degrees F with medium pressure recommended. Since all heat press' can heat differently if you experience not enough heat up your degrees 10.
  • Did you pre-press your garment? If not, you must. This process removes the excess moisture in the garment to ensure the screen print will transfer. It also removes any wrinkles. We recommend a 5 second pre-press.
  • Did you place the transfer face down? You must position your transfer face down.
  • How long did you press? You should only be pressing for 5 seconds! If you press too long it will burn the transfer.
  • Did you peel it Hot? These must be peeled off while Hot-Peel in a smooth even motion. If you peel cold it will pull off the transfer from your garment. HOT PEEL.

Other factors that may be affecting your application:

DO NOT USE A TEFLON SHEET. The teflon sheet will actually block the heat making the transfer not able to adhere correctly.

DO NOT USE PRESSING PILLOWS. Using these will affect the even distribution of heat and will make the transfer not able to adhere correctly.

GARMENT NOT LAYING FLAT. Wrinkles or creases will affect the application and not allow the transfer to fully adhere correctly. Buttons, pockets, & seams can also present problems. Avoid these areas when applying.

SCREEN PRINT PEELING UP: This is likely the cause of your heat press temperature not being accurate. Try using 10 degrees hotter. If you still experience this, your pressure may not be high enough for the transfer to release to your shirt.
